A timing synchronization method performed in a terminal may comprise receiving information on a common delay of a service link between the terminal and a base station from the base station; transmitting a physical random access channel (PRACH) preamble to the base station by reflecting the common delay with respect to a random access channel (RACH) occasion associated with a synchronization signal/physical broadcast channel (SS/PBCH) block received from the base station; receiving a first random access response (RAR) including a timing adjustment value reflecting a differential delay between the terminal and the base station from the base station; and performing uplink transmission to the base station by reflecting the common delay and the timing adjustment value.

Disclosed is a method for configuring a bandwidth for supporting a broadband carrier in a communication system. An operation method of a base station comprises the steps of: configuring a first bandwidth part and a second bandwidth part for a terminal; configuring a reserved resource for the first bandwidth part in a resource area in which the first bandwidth part and the second bandwidth part overlap; and performing an operation of transmitting or receiving a second data channel, which is scheduled to the second bandwidth part, together with the terminal by using the reserved resource. Therefore, the performance of the communication system can be improved.

Disclosed is an operation method of a base station in a mobile communication system. The operation method may comprise performing a beam management procedure for selecting at least one beam and transmitting a different channel state information reference signal (CSI-RS) for each beam to a terminal through the at least one beam; receiving a beam quality information for the at least one beam from the terminal; transmitting at least one CSI-RS for CSI acquisition configured according a beam management update procedure based on the beam quality information to the terminal through at least one beam; and receiving a CSI based the CSI-RS for CSI acquisition from the terminal.

A method and an apparatus for transmitting data in communication between terminals are provided. A terminal disposes at least one first reference signal configured based on a first parameter. The terminal disposes at least one second reference signal configured based on a second parameter, in addition to the first reference signal configured based on a first parameter. Data of a first structure in which the first reference signal is included or data of a second structure in which the first reference signal and the second reference signal are included is transmitted.
